Procurement & Vendor Relations Specialist

San Jose, CA (On-site)

About the role

We are seeking a Procurement & Vendor Relations Specialist to join our operations team. In this role, you will be the primary point of contact for all hardware and software procurement activities, with a particular focus on GPU servers, networking equipment, storage systems, and management infrastructure sourced from NVIDIA and leading OEM partners.
This is a highly strategic and relationship-driven role. You will work closely with our engineering, finance, and legal teams to ensure that every procurement decision is executed with precision, speed, and full compliance — helping Ricloud AI build world-class AI infrastructure on time and within budget.

Responsibilities

Vendor Procurement & Management

  • Lead end-to-end procurement of GPU servers (including NVIDIA DGX and HGX systems), high-speed networking equipment, storage servers, and management servers from NVIDIA and authorized OEM partners.

  • Develop, maintain, and deepen strategic relationships with NVIDIA account teams, authorized resellers, and OEM manufacturers to ensure priority access, favorable pricing, and reliable supply.

  • Negotiate contracts, pricing, delivery terms, and service-level agreements with vendors on behalf of the company.

  • Manage the full vendor lifecycle, including vendor qualification, onboarding, performance evaluation, and ongoing relationship management.

Procurement Operations

  • Process and manage purchase orders, ensuring accuracy, timeliness, and alignment with project requirements and budgets.

  • Coordinate with engineering and infrastructure teams to understand hardware specifications, lead times, and deployment schedules.

  • Track order status, manage delivery timelines, and proactively resolve any supply chain issues or delays.

  • Maintain accurate and up-to-date procurement records, contracts, and vendor documentation.

Compliance & Due Diligence

  • Ensure all procurement activities comply with applicable U.S. regulations, export control laws, and company policies.

  • Conduct thorough vendor compliance reviews, including verification of authorized reseller status, product authenticity, and regulatory certifications.

  • Collaborate with the legal and finance teams to review and execute vendor agreements in a timely and compliant manner.

  • Stay current with NVIDIA partner program requirements, OEM certification standards, and relevant industry regulations.

Cross-Functional Collaboration

  • Work closely with the finance team to manage procurement budgets, forecasts, and cost optimization initiatives.

  • Partner with the engineering team to evaluate new hardware products and vendor offerings as the technology landscape evolves.

  • Support the broader operations team with any additional procurement or administrative needs as the company grows.

Required Qualifications

Experience

  • 3–7 years of experience in hardware procurement, vendor management, or supply chain operations, ideally within the data center, AI infrastructure, or enterprise technology industry.

  • Prior experience working at or directly with NVIDIA, a NVIDIA-authorized partner, or a major OEM manufacturer (such as Dell Technologies, HPE, Supermicro, Lenovo, or Inspur) is strongly preferred — as this role requires an immediate, deep understanding of vendor processes, partner programs, and procurement channels.

  • Demonstrated experience procuring large-scale GPU systems, server hardware, networking equipment, or storage solutions.

  • Familiarity with NVIDIA's product portfolio (DGX, HGX, networking, software licensing) and partner ecosystem is a significant advantage.

Skills & Competencies

  • Exceptional relationship-building and interpersonal skills, with the ability to engage confidently and warmly with vendor representatives, account managers, and executive stakeholders.

  • Strong negotiation skills with a track record of securing favorable terms and pricing.

  • Highly organized and detail-oriented, with the ability to manage multiple procurement processes simultaneously without losing accuracy or urgency.

  • Solid understanding of U.S. procurement compliance, export control regulations, and vendor due diligence best practices.

  • Proficiency with procurement tools, ERP systems, and standard office productivity software.

  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ills in English.

Personal Qualities

  • A proactive, self-motivated professional who takes ownership and follows through with care and accountability.

  • A collaborative team player who thrives in a fast-paced, entrepreneurial environment.

  • Someone who genuinely enjoys building long-term relationships and takes pride in being a trusted partner — both internally and with our vendor community.
